Back to the Commander IIs, I have been reading a lot about them on the Star forum especially for the Stratoliner I just took possession of. Most there seem to think they are the best tire for that bike and I have not read anything about the tire loosing traction on wet pavement. I put the Bridgestone Exedra Max on my Stratoliner (Yamato) as they have served me well on Brahma for 70K+ miles now. I will write a report on them with Yamato once I have a few thousand miles on them with that bike.

The Commander IIIs are out now with rave reviews from the Star crowd but no one there has more than a thousand miles that has reported anything. From what is read, the C-IIIs should have even longer life. That oftentimes means less traction but not always. I do what to keep following such news as long life and traction on wet roads is vital to my lifestyle. I get around 13K miles on a set of Exedra maxes, more would be awesome...
